What is Arroz con Frijoles?

Mexican rice and beans β€” fluffy tomato-seasoned rice paired with creamy refried or pot beans. The foundation of every Mexican meal.

Where is Arroz con Frijoles from?

Arroz con Frijoles originates from Mexico City in Mexico. It is considered one of the defining dishes of Mexico's culinary tradition.

What does Arroz con Frijoles taste like?

Arroz con Frijoles has a tomato-seasoned, earthy, and comforting flavour profile.

What are the main ingredients in Arroz con Frijoles?

The traditional recipe for Arroz con Frijoles includes: Rice, tomatoes, onion, garlic, chicken broth, pinto/black beans, lard, epazote.
